Rachel's hope

2014
Rachel has escaped the anti-semitic violence of her home town in Russia, and has finally arrived in California to start a new life despite the challenges of poverty and the great California earthquake.

Rachel's promise

2013
In 1903, Rachel, a Jew who left Russia with her family on the Trans-Siberian Railway to the coast to board a ship for Shanghai, China, and her friend Sergei, who left home for a factory job in St. Petersburg and joined rebelling workers, write letters to one another, describing the challenges they face and hope for their futures.

Rachel's secret

2012
As a Jew living in Kishinev, Russia, in 1903, Rachel has seen a lot of dark times. She doesn't want the society standard life of a mother and wife. She would much rather be a writer. When her Christian friend Mikhail is murdered, everything turns on the Jews--the Christian community becomes outspokenly violent and anti-Semitic. Only her friendship with and growing love for Sergei, a Christian, keeps Rachel's hopes alive.
